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Water Safety Fundamentals: Understanding backcountry water hazards, basic safety guidelines, and emergency procedures. โ€ข Water Treatment Methods: Examining various techniques for treating backcountry water, including chemical, UV, and mechanical treatments. โ€ข Waterborne Pathogens: Identifying common waterborne pathogens, their sources, and health impacts. โ€ข Backcountry Hygiene: Establishing hygienic practices to minimize the risk of waterborne illnesses. โ€ข Watershed Ecology: Exploring the interdependence of watersheds, wildlife, and human activities. โ€ข Stream Ecology: Understanding the ecology of streams, including the importance of aquatic insects and the impact of human activities. โ€ข Conservation Practices: Examining best practices for conserving backcountry water resources and minimizing human impact. โ€ข Leave No Trace Principles: Applying Leave No Trace principles to backcountry water use, including proper disposal of waste and reducing the spread of invasive species. โ€ข Water Quality Testing: Learning how to test backcountry water quality and interpret results.
